    Self-assessment tools

    There are a myriad of self-assessment instruments that can be used to aid adults suffering from ADHD to diagnose their condition and monitor it. The ASRS (Adult Syndrome Rating Scale) is one of the most widely used tools.

    The ASRS is a self-report measurement of the 18 DSM-IV-TR criteria. Patients are asked to rate their symptoms using a scale that ranges from very few times to extremely frequently. These questions have good concurrent validity.

    Adults who score four or more Part-A scores are thought to have a diagnosis of ADHD. They should be evaluated by a doctor or therapist or any other healthcare professional. If an adult is suffering from symptoms of ADHD that persist, they should also be screened for disorders of impulse control.

    Many websites provide online self-assessments. These tools are available for free. They are not intended to diagnose the disorder, and they do not provide the complete picture of symptoms.

    The World Health Organization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(v1.1) is the most commonly used assessment tool for adults. It is a scale of six questions. It is the best instrument to diagnose adults with ADHD.

    DIVA-5 Diagnostic Interview for Adults is a different tool that can be used to diagnose ADHD in adults. It was created by a psychiatrist in the Netherlands and was translated into many languages. Its English version is now available to download. The cost of translation is covered by a small fee that is paid by the not-for profit organization.

    The 40-item self report scale assesses a patient's ADHD symptoms. Although it isn't free however, it is among the most frequently employed in research studies. The results can be used to monitor ADHD symptoms over time. The results can then be reviewed with a healthcare professional.

    The Women's ADHD Self-Assessment and Symptom Inventory is another tool that can be used to evaluate the symptoms of an adult adhd assessment. This online tool is specially created for women. It addresses issues that impact women's lives, including anxiety disorders and problems with concentration.

    The self-assessment tools for diagnosing ADHD are simple and easy to use. These tools can provide information about your symptoms and be used to aid with future referrals or lifestyle adjustments.

    Protocols for assessment of adhd

    Assessment of adult ADHD consists of clinical interviews and tests. It also includes standard scales for assessing behavior. The assessment can be conducted by a psychologist or a doctor, or it may be conducted by someone in the family. A thorough examination can take several hours, however, the results can be helpful for determining the best treatment strategy for the patient.

    ADHD sufferers often experience problems with concentration and difficulty working on tasks. They may also display working memory and set shifting issues. They also report feeling frustrated and ashamed of their issues. They are expected to be able, once diagnosed correctly and working with their doctors and family to improve their quality life.

    Before making an adult ADHD diagnosis, a psychiatrist must conduct a thorough examination of the symptoms. The doctor will then determine the extent to which symptoms affect the daily routine. This will include questions about the inability to exercise, fainting episodes, and syncope.

    Parents, teachers and other adults who have worked with the patient in the past may be consult with. Ask for their ratings scales or observations. Use a clinician who has experience in ADHD.

    Interviews with the patient as well as their spouse are essential. They can help the clinician determine how the symptoms of ADHD affect the family and the relationship. The spouse can help to build empathy for the symptoms of the patient.

    A conversation with the doctor about substance use by the child is also an excellent idea. This is especially important if the individual is an adult or adolescent. It is important to keep any inquiry regarding the use of substances private.

    A comprehensive evaluation should include the DSM-5 checklist of symptoms and other types of psychometric testing. It should also incorporate the patient's environment.
